In such ways as scrubber technology, electrostatic technology, measurement and analytical technology, water treatment technology, heat recovery technology, and control technology, we at Fuji Electric have enhanced our core areas of expertise. These are all the results of decades of experience with our research and development efforts with land-based technologies. Now, we are re-applying our core technologies and expertise from the land to the sea. Through optimal integration of proprietary technology and other products and technologies, Fuji Electric has created a new value-added solution for ships.

For more than 90 years, Fuji Electric has been innovating electric and thermal energy technologies, which form the core of society’s electricity use. We cover a broad range of business segments: from power electronics systems, power and new energy, and electronic devices to food and beverage distribution. Our aim is to bridge the gap between energy concerns and environmental health.

As a result of decades of working to optimize energy use and minimize environmental impact on land, Fuji Electric has managed to meet stringent land-based standards. To meet a new frontier of environmental regulation, we are now extending our goal to the oceans.

Taking our years of experience from land to sea, we seek to provide customers with an environment-friendly, energy-saving solution for ships. This notion is conveyed in the SaveBlue concept.

Creative use of space and resources is a hallmark of ship design, and it is the guiding philosophy behind Fuji Electric’s SOx scrubber and laser gas analyser.

Fuji Electric’s solution, SaveBlue, is an exhaust gas cleaning system (EGCS) that allows continued use of heavy fuel oil (HFO): it has open-loop and closed-loop operation modes. With a compact size that facilitates ease of installation, it is suitable for both retrofitting and new builds.
